Starting School or Transferring from another School

Children normally start school in the September following their fourth birthday. For this school, Gloucestershire County Council are the Admission Authority and applications for a place in the Reception group must be made via them. This link will take you to the appropriate website:

If your child has Special Educational Needs and Disabilities our SENDCo will work with you to understand any adaptations that might be necessary to put in place, in order to make the transition into our school as smooth as possible. 

For pupils already at school and seeking a place at Southrop, admissions are managed by the school itself. In the first instance you should telephone the school to enquire about vacancies. The school is very popular and as we can only take eight pupils in each year group, there are normally very few spaces. Having spoken to the school, if we may be able to accommodate your child you will be asked to come to meet one of the Co-Head Teachers so that we can fully understand the needs of your child. You are then welcome to make an application on the form downloadable below. As soon as the school receives this application you will be notified in writing as to whether or not a place can be offered. In the event that one cannot be offered you will be given advice about how the In-Year Admissions team at Gloucestershire County Council can help you with either an appeal or to find a place in an alternative school.
